What is the meaning of risk premium in the context of digital currencies?

- Nanda PermanaMar 02, 2024 · 2 years agoThe risk premium in the context of digital currencies refers to the additional return that investors expect to receive for holding a cryptocurrency compared to a risk-free investment. It represents the compensation for the higher risk associated with investing in volatile and decentralized digital assets. The risk premium is influenced by factors such as market sentiment, regulatory developments, technological advancements, and overall market conditions. A higher risk premium indicates a higher perceived risk and potential for greater returns. However, it also implies a higher level of uncertainty and volatility. Investors should carefully assess the risk premium when considering investing in digital currencies to make informed decisions based on their risk tolerance and investment goals.
